Show moreDiscover the breathtaking and poignant journey of "We Are Not Like Them: A Novel," crafted by acclaimed author, Jo Piazza and Christine Pride. This gripping narrative explores the complexities of friendship between two women, one Black and one white, as they navigate the tumultuous landscape of race, privilege, and identity. In a world rife with social unrest, this novel delves deep into the heartfelt moments that challenge their bond when a tragic event tears their lives apart, testing loyalty and love amid chaos. Each page resonates with raw emotion, provoking thought and discussion long after the final chapter is read.
